1Mix basics

Concrete is cement + water + aggregates — and the proportions decide everything.

The two numbers you'll hear about most on site are slump and air:

  • Slump — how workable the mix is. A typical general-construction mix runs 75–100 mm; pump mixes and some structural placements want more. Higher slump usually means more water — and more water means less strength, so the spec sets the range for a reason.
  • Air content — microscopic air bubbles that protect the concrete from freeze-thaw damage. In Ontario, exterior concrete commonly targets 5–8% air. Air is tested on the truck, not guessed.

Mix requirements come from the project spec (in Ontario, typically OPSS) and the engineer's design — the numbers here are typical ranges, not universal.

2Volume & ordering

Concrete is ordered by the cubic metre — and a little waste goes a long way.

Volume (m³) = Length (m) × Width (m) × Depth (m)

Example: a slab 12 m × 5 m × 0.15 m = 9.0 m³. Add waste and form/ground irregularities — 5–10% is common on earth-formed work — and you're ordering ~9.5–10 m³. A ready-mix truck typically hauls around 6–7 m³, so this pour is roughly a truck and a half.

3Placement

Everything you do at the chute either helps the pour or costs you strength.

  • Don't add water on site. Water added at the chute to "loosen it up" changes the water-cement ratio and drops strength. If the mix isn't working, call the dispatcher — don't drown it.
  • Consolidate, don't over-vibrate. Internal vibration settles the concrete into the forms and around rebar, but running the vibrator too long can separate the mix and bleed out the fines.
  • Place it before it sets. Concrete has a working life measured in hours (and heat makes it shorter). Plan the pour so trucks aren't waiting and the finishers aren't racing the set.
Field tipCheck the ticket. The spec'd slump, air, strength and mix ID are all on the delivery ticket — verify them before the truck dumps, not after.

4Curing

Concrete doesn't dry to strength — it cures, and it needs water to do it.

Cement gains strength through a chemical reaction that needs moisture. If the surface dries out early, the top of the slab stays weak and dusts. Standard practice is to keep concrete moist for the first several days (specs commonly call for 7 days): wet burlap, a curing compound, or ponding on flatwork. In cold weather, protect fresh concrete from freezing until it has gained enough strength — freezing early is permanent damage.

5Strength & testing

Slump and air are checked on the truck — strength is proven with cylinders.

The slump test measures workability — the drop in mm after the cone is lifted.

Cylinders are cast from the same truckload, cured in the lab, and crushed at the specified age — usually 28 days, with 7-day breaks as an early check. A typical structural mix might be specified at 30–35 MPa at 28 days. The spec sets how many cylinders to take (often per set number of cubic metres or per pour).

6Field tips

The stuff you learn standing at the chute.

Field tip — orderingOrder by the cubic metre and round up for waste. Coming up short mid-pour is a cold joint and a headache; a little extra concrete in the truck is easier to deal with.
Field tip — slumpA higher slump isn't "better" — it's usually extra water. If the mix is stiff, talk to the plant before anyone adds water.
Field tip — cylindersCast cylinders the moment the load arrives, label them with pour/date/location, and get them to the lab or curing setup — a cylinder that dries out proves nothing.
